5 Proven Tips to Share Your Pregnancy Announcement
1. Social Media Reveal — Share with a Bang!

You can create a fun post on social media to announce your pregnancy. This method is perfect for those who love sharing their lives online. Use a cute photo, a creative caption, or even a video to spread the news. Remember to tag friends and family to ensure everyone sees your announcement!
To start, choose a photo that captures your excitement, like a picture of baby shoes or a family photo with a “Coming Soon” sign. One warning: be ready for a flood of comments and congratulations!

2. Family Gathering — Make It Personal

Host a family gathering and announce the pregnancy in person! This intimate setting allows you to share your joy directly with loved ones. You can plan a themed dinner or simply gather everyone for a casual hangout.
During the event, you can reveal the news through a toast or a special dessert with a hidden message. Just be prepared for lots of hugs and happy tears!
3. Custom Announcement Cards — Go Traditional

Consider sending out custom announcement cards to family and friends. This classic method adds a personal touch that many will appreciate. You can design a card with a photo and your announcement message.
To start, choose a design that matches your personality. Websites like Canva or Etsy offer many customizable options. Remember, traditional mail means your news will take a bit longer to reach everyone!
4. Fun Prop Reveal — Get Creative

Use props to make your announcement memorable! You can take a fun photo holding a sign, wearing a t-shirt that says “Baby on Board,” or using a chalkboard to write your message. This method is great for those who love photography and creativity.
To start, gather your props and set up a little photo shoot. One tip: make sure the lighting is good to capture the best moment!
5. Video Announcement — Share Your Story

Create a short video to announce your pregnancy! This could include clips from your journey so far, or you could tell your story directly to the camera. Video announcements are engaging and allow you to share your emotions in a unique way.
You can edit the video using apps like iMovie or Adobe Spark. Just be ready for lots of views and shares!

Frequently Asked Questions
Can I announce my pregnancy before the first trimester?
Yes! Many choose to share their pregnancy news early, but it’s a personal decision based on comfort level.
How long should I wait to announce my pregnancy?
There’s no set rule; many wait until the end of the first trimester, but you should announce when you feel ready.
Do I need to send out cards for my announcement?
No, sending cards is optional! You can choose any method that feels right for you.
What if I’m worried about negative reactions?
It’s normal to be concerned, but most reactions are positive. Focus on your happiness and joy!
What’s the best way to share with family?
In-person gatherings often create the most memorable experiences when sharing with family. It allows for immediate reactions!
